-
- цифровой сигнал собирает аналоговый с интервалом частоты
дискретизации (см. кртинку). Например оцифровываем синусоиду с
частотой 1Гц частотой 2Гц. Если момент семплирования совпадет с
переходом через 0, вместо синусоиды мы получим 0. Другая ситуации
синус 1Гц и дискретизация 2.001Гц, поначалу попадаем в переходы
через 0, и только через 1000 периодов мы сможем узнать амплитуду
синусоиды. Короче, частота дискретизации должна минимум в 4 раза
быть больше. IBAH(1 знак., 16.04.2022 16:13, картинка)
- А если частоту сэмплирования в процессе измерения несколько раз
менять? Такой способ должен позволить обойти эту проблему. Бoмж(77 знак., 17.04.2022 01:00)
- Вот завтра с утра и займусь. Спасибо. И всем спасибо, кто дело советовал. А настроение таки, да. - Бapбoc(17.04.2022 10:50)
- Мы все учились. Вот тут случай такой. Как бы это сказать-то. Было у
меня подозрение, что делаю неправильно, но с 345-м всё прокатило. И
катило пять лет и тысячи экземпляров. А тут вдруг. Бapбoc(10 знак., 16.04.2022 16:14)
- Шум помогает математически увеличить разрядность оцифровки только
когда он внеполосный. Но при этом (при оверсэмплинге) и частота
дискретизации должна быть в разы выше, чем максимальная полоса
полезного сигнала. 100SPS для оцифровки 50 Гц явно недостаточно. На
порядок бы поднять частоту сэмплирования, чтобы потом
отфильтровать. - reZident(16.04.2022 17:22)
- Это другое. Это исторически сложилось. Типа "ой, работает", да и
хрен с ним. Это просто у меня по таймеру запускается опрос
акселерометра, там на этом таймере дохера чего висит. Стандартная
тема про оверсемплинг тут нипричём. На порядок не получится. - Бapбoc(16.04.2022 18:11)
- Таймер срабатывает с частотой 100 Гц. Сделать с частотой 200Гц, но
всё опрашивать только каждый второй раз, а акселератор каждый раз.
Не вариант? - symbions(16.04.2022 22:53)
- Собственно, других вариантов и нет. Да вы, сударь, истинный
телепат. - Бapбoc(17.04.2022 11:32)
- ТОгда не понял в чём проблема - symbions(17.04.2022 14:03)
- Дык, пока персты не вложу, не поверю. А пока лежу на диване и фантазирую. - Бapбoc(17.04.2022 14:10)
- ТОгда не понял в чём проблема - symbions(17.04.2022 14:03)
- Собственно, других вариантов и нет. Да вы, сударь, истинный
телепат. - Бapбoc(17.04.2022 11:32)
- Таймер срабатывает с частотой 100 Гц. Сделать с частотой 200Гц, но
всё опрашивать только каждый второй раз, а акселератор каждый раз.
Не вариант? - symbions(16.04.2022 22:53)
- Это другое. Это исторически сложилось. Типа "ой, работает", да и
хрен с ним. Это просто у меня по таймеру запускается опрос
акселерометра, там на этом таймере дохера чего висит. Стандартная
тема про оверсемплинг тут нипричём. На порядок не получится. - Бapбoc(16.04.2022 18:11)
- а есть доступ к экземпляру на предыдущем акселе? сделать тест прошивки, чтобы с обоих сэмплить побыстрее, эдак в килогерц, а потом открыть результаты оцифровки в экселе каком, да сравнить. и математику можно разную к записанным данным применять. - Mahagam(16.04.2022 16:36)
- Только не шум... Как вариант, гармоника частоты семплирования умножалась на сигнал, по питанию пролазило - IBAH(16.04.2022 16:36)
- Шум помогает математически увеличить разрядность оцифровки только
когда он внеполосный. Но при этом (при оверсэмплинге) и частота
дискретизации должна быть в разы выше, чем максимальная полоса
полезного сигнала. 100SPS для оцифровки 50 Гц явно недостаточно. На
порядок бы поднять частоту сэмплирования, чтобы потом
отфильтровать. - reZident(16.04.2022 17:22)
- А если частоту сэмплирования в процессе измерения несколько раз
менять? Такой способ должен позволить обойти эту проблему. Бoмж(77 знак., 17.04.2022 01:00)
- цифровой сигнал собирает аналоговый с интервалом частоты
дискретизации (см. кртинку). Например оцифровываем синусоиду с
частотой 1Гц частотой 2Гц. Если момент семплирования совпадет с
переходом через 0, вместо синусоиды мы получим 0. Другая ситуации
синус 1Гц и дискретизация 2.001Гц, поначалу попадаем в переходы
через 0, и только через 1000 периодов мы сможем узнать амплитуду
синусоиды. Короче, частота дискретизации должна минимум в 4 раза
быть больше. IBAH(1 знак., 16.04.2022 16:13, картинка)